DESCRIPTION:Pulau Ujong\, or “Island at the End”\, is one of the oldest recorded names for Singapore. But what was it like at the beginning\, before humans started transforming the landscape? What lifeforms once filled its rainforests and rivers\, and which ones are now extinct? With temperatures soaring twice as fast as the rest of the world\, what will this island’s future look like? \nWritten with heartfelt insight by award-winning playwright Alfian Sa’at\, Pulau Ujong is a riveting piece of documentary theatre featuring interviews with climate scientists\, botanists\, zoologists\, environmental historians and activists. Their words\, wishes and worries for the world take centre stage alongside the more-than-human voices we all need to hear – from zoo mascot Ah Meng to Singapore’s last tiger. \nBrought to thrilling\, kaleidoscopic heights by director Edith Podesta and a brilliant ensemble cast\, Pulau Ujong is both an elegy and a cry of hope. At a time when we can no longer afford to turn a blind eye to climate change as it ravages the entire planet\, Pulau Ujong invites audiences to re-acquaint themselves with the miracles and mysteries of the natural world. \nStarring Al-Matin Yatim\, Ryan Ang\, Koh Wan Ching\, Krish Natarajan\, Siti Khalijah Zainal\nDuration: approximately 1 hour 30 minutes (with no interval)\nIMDA Rating: TBA

DESCRIPTION:A tentative stroke step sketch or song can blossom at ART:DIS. Your child can experience what it’s like to learn in an inclusive and safe space at our Open House. Conducted by instructors with years of experience in teaching students with differentiated learning needs children can participate in workshops or make art with friends. We welcome one and all to share in our joy of the arts. \nARTDIS (Singapore) Ltd formerly known as Very Special Arts Singapore is a leading charity dedicated to creating learning and livelihood opportunities for persons with disabilities in the arts. \nStarted in 1993 by Ambassador-at-Large Professor Tommy Koh ART:DIS organises programmes workshops projects collaborations exhibitions and performances for persons with disabilities to reach for excellence and be relevant for the future.

DESCRIPTION:Make Hantus Great Again is a satirical\, supernatural\, and political comedy. It follows the General Elections of the Convention of Metaphysical Entities (COME)\, the national administrative body (and support group) for Singapore’s population of hantus (ghosts)\, pontianaks\, vampires\, jiang shis\, and other supernatural beings. Each race sends forth a candidate\, each with their own crazed agenda. Will the vampires bring an orgy of anarchy? Will the jinn impose their own brand of magical dictatorship? Or will the ghosts… make hantus great again? That’s for the audience to decide as their vote will determine the result of the most important elections of their lives… and afterlives. \nMake Hantus Great Again marks the theatrical debut of best-selling author\, Suffian Hakim (of Harris Bin Potter and the Stoned Philosopher fame). Directed by Rizman Putra\, Make Hantus Great Again stars Hafidz Rahman\, Munah Bagharib\, Azizul ‘Izzy’ Mahathir\, Farah Lola\, Jamil Schulze\, Neo Hai Bin\, and Norisham Osman.
